Captivation Software is looking for a senior level systems administrator who shall be responsible for providing support for a large-scale Linux system including installation of COTS/GOTS/FOSS software, day-to-day operations, monitoring, and problem resolution for all the compute, network, memory, and storage system components. In addition, the System Administrator shall maintain the system security integrity and configure network components, along with implementing operating systems enhancements to improve reliability and performance.
RequirementsSecurity Clearance:
- Must currently hold a Top Secret/SCI U.S. Government security clearance with a favorable Polygraph, therefore all candidates must be a U.S. citizen
- Fifteen (15) years' experience as a Systems Administrator in programs and contracts of similar scope, type, and complexity is required
- Bachelor's degree in a technical discipline from an accredited college or university is required
- Five (5) years of additional Systems Administration experience may be substituted for a bachelor's degree.
- A Security+ Certification is required
- Experience using the Linux CLI
- Experience developing scripts using Bash/Python
- Experience in performing System Administration including installation, configuration, and support of COTS/GOTS/FOSS software in a large-scale Linux cluster environment
- General technical knowledge regarding compute, network, memory, and storage system components
- Experience with Red Hat Satellite systems management solution
- Familiarity using Splunk for ingesting, indexing, searching, monitoring, and analyzing big data
- Experience with the sustainment and support of large Linux clusters including day-to-day operations, monitoring and problem resolution
- Experience configuring and sustaining VMware ESXi/Virtualization environments
- Experience with IaC (Infrastructure as Code) principles and automation tools such as SaltStack and Ansible
- Experience with corporate STE/STN security compliance policies and procedures
- Experience using system monitoring tools such as HPE One View and Nagios
- Experience with containerization technologies such as Docker
- Experience with container orchestration technologies such as Kubernetes
- Experience with distributed files systems such as Weka, CEPH, GPFS, and HDFS
- Experience with the Atlassian Suite of Tools such as Jira and Confluence
